C++光线追踪渲染器初级版
发布于 2021-05-27
本文使用c++在qt平台实现了简易的光线追踪离线渲染器,支持实时观看渲染过程。实现的功能有:光追基本算法、三种材质、一种纹理、两种基本物体形状、反走样等技
本文使用c++在qt平台实现了简易的光线追踪离线渲染器,支持实时观看渲染过程。实现的功能有:光追基本算法、三种材质、一种纹理、两种基本物体形状、反走样等技
本文介绍了若干种经典的BRDF模型,并使用unity-shader做了简单的复现;此外根据辐射度算法理论和BRDF的性质,推导了几个重要的渲染方程公式。<
本文使用c++语言,利用qt框架编写一个光栅化软渲染器。首先介绍渲染管线的基本流程,然后讲述了c++的特性使用,并搭建了简单的数学框架。